How a dehumidifier works in Nesbit

The idea is simple: the unit draws in damp air, the moisture condenses and collects in a tank (or drains away), and drier air is pushed back into the room. For a cellar or cold room in Nesbit, you'll want a model suited to cool spaces and matched to the volume you're drying.

Your Nesbit hire questions

What size dehumidifier do I need in Nesbit?

For a cold or unheated room, choose a compressor model rated for low temperatures and matched to the room size. Skip the little moisture absorbers — they're too small for a genuinely damp room in Nesbit.

Are dehumidifiers expensive to run?

Running costs stay reasonable: a domestic unit often runs a few hours a day thanks to the built-in humidistat, which switches it off once the target humidity is reached.

Is hiring worth it for a homeowner?

If the need is short-term, hiring is the smarter move: no expensive unit sitting idle afterwards, and you get the right model for the problem in Nesbit straight away.

How long until I see a difference in Nesbit?

It depends how wet things are: condensation clears in days, while a flooded space in Nesbit may need a week or more of continuous running.

Will a dehumidifier get rid of black mould?

Yes, indirectly — mould thrives on damp air. Keep things dry and you stop it regrowing. For heavy growth, treat the surface first, then dry the room.
